NAME

       appletviewer - Java applet viewer


SYNOPSIS

       appletviewer [ options ] urls ...


DESCRIPTION

       The  appletviewer command connects to the documents or resources desig-
       nated by urls and displays each applet referenced by that  document  in
       its own window.  Note: if the documents referred to by urls do not ref-
       erence any applets with the OBJECT, EMBED, or APPLET tag,  appletviewer
       does nothing.  For details on the HTML tags that appletviewer supports,
       see http://java.sun.com/j2se/1.5.0/docs/tooldocs/appletviewertags.html.


OPTIONS

       The following options are supported:

       -debug    Starts  the  applet  viewer  in the Java debugger, jdb , thus
                 allowing you to debug applets in the document.  (See jdb(1).)

       -encoding encoding_name
                 Specifies the input HTML file encoding name.

       -Joption  Passes  the string option through as a single argument to the
                 Java interpreter which runs the appletviewer.   The  argument
                 should  not contain spaces.  Multiple argument words must all
                 begin with the prefix -J, which is stripped.  This is  useful
                 for  adjusting  the  compiler's execution environment or com-
                 piler memory usage.
